Acquisition parameters
Image ID (picno): E09-02575
Image start time: 2001-10-30T05:37:26.58 SCET
Image width: 672 pixels
Image height: 6784 pixels
Line integration time: 0.4821 millisec
Pixel aspect ratio: 0.93
Crosstrack summing: 3
Downtrack summing: 3
Compression type: MOC-PRED-X-5
Gain mode: 8A (hexadecimal)
Offset mode: 32 (decimal)
|
Derived values
Longitude of image center: 326.73°W Latitude of image center: 21.09°N Scaled pixel width: 4.73 meters Scaled image width: 3.18 km Scaled image height: 29.80 km Solar longitude (Ls): 262.27° Local True Solar Time: 13.88 decimal hours Emission angle: 18.16° Incidence angle: 53.65° Phase angle: 68.96° North azimuth: 93.20° Sun azimuth: 305.51° Spacecraft altitude: 401.78 km Slant distance: 420.43 km |
